Lysis of about 90% of the cells of Acetobacter xylinum by lysozyme may be obtained after 2 hours at pH 8.1 in phosphate–citrate buffer. The cell population is heterogeneous since the remaining 10% of the cells do not lyse, even on repetition of the above treatment.

Acetobacter is a gram negative, obligate aerobe coccus or rod shaped bacterium with the size of 0.6-0.8 X 1.0 - 4.0 μm, nonmotile or motile with peritrichous flagella, catalase positive and oxidase negative biochemically. SUMMARY: The cells in a developing culture of Acetobacter xylinum in a static liquid glucose medium were swept to the surface by the flotation of a submerged cellulose net. The net was probably pulled to the surface by adsorbed carbon dioxide given off by the metabolizing cells. Rice bran was introduced as an alternative nitrogen source to Hestrin and Schramm (HS) medium in HS Acetobacter xylinum culture media in bacterial cellulose (B.C) synthesis. The results indicated an unchanged composition of crude protein per increase in incubation days while diluted protein increased with incubation period.
